Entity Framework (EF) Core is a lightweight, extensible, open source and cross-platform version of the popular Entity Framework data access technology. Enables .NET developers to work with a database using .NET objects. Eliminates the need for most of the data-access code that typically needs to be written. With EF Core, data access is performed using a model. A model is made up of entity classes and a context object that represents a session with the database. The context object allows querying and saving data. Generate a model from an existing database. Hand code a model to match the database. Once a model is created, use EF migrations to create a database from the model. Migrations allow evolving the database as the model changes. Instances of your entity classes are retrieved from the database using Language Integrated Query (LINQ). Data is created, deleted, and modified in the database using instances of your entity classes.

Tabular is an open table store from the creators of Apache Iceberg. Connect multiple computing engines and frameworks. Decrease query time and storage costs by up to 50%. Centralize enforcement of data access (RBAC) policies. Connect any query engine or framework, including Athena, BigQuery, Redshift, Snowflake, Databricks, Trino, Spark, and Python. Smart compaction, clustering, and other automated data services reduce storage costs and query times by up to 50%. Unify data access at the database or table. RBAC controls are simple to manage, consistently enforced, and easy to audit. Centralize your security down to the table. Tabular is easy to use plus it features high-powered ingestion, performance, and RBAC under the hood. Tabular gives you the flexibility to work with multiple “best of breed” compute engines based on their strengths. Assign privileges at the data warehouse database, table, or column level.
